Certificate 4 in Community Services Work (CHC40708)

Description: The Certificate IV in Community Services Work is designed for workers where counselling is a complementary part of their work role.

This qualification would also be suitable for people who are interested in entering the community services workforce or who are exploring the possibility of moving into the counselling field.

This qualification (alone) is not designed to give the graduate the skills to practice as a counsellor.

National Recognised Qualification

Duration: 12 months

Entry Requirements: No prior knowledge or experience

Application process includes short essay and interview

Subjects:

  • Theories of Counselling
  • Counselling Skills 1
  • Counselling Skills 2
  • Ethics and Administration
  • Working Across Cultures and Diverse Backgrounds
  • Child Protection Issues
  • Community Development: Theory and Practice
  • Case Management 1
  • Workplace Project
  • Occupational Health and Safety

Students then can move into the Diploma of Counselling. Exemptions will be given for subjects successfully completed and the Diploma can then be completed in one year.
